Common Phases


1. Without further ado
- Used to mean without wasting any more time; immediately.
2. Make much ado about nothing
- To make a fuss about something trivial or unimportant.
3. With little/no ado
- In a very simple manner, without much fuss or fanfare.
4. Without more/further ado
- Without delaying any longer; immediately.
